In chain termination sequencing, which of the following terminates the chain? The lack of a base at the 1 ' carbon The lack of \( \mathrm{OH} \) at the 2' carbon The lack of \( \mathrm{OH} \) at the \( 3^{\prime} \) carbon The lack of phosphate at the \( 5^{\prime} \) carbon
